The proposed resolution aims to amend the Rules of Organization and Procedures for the Council of the District of Columbia to allow the Committee of the Whole to conduct official business during the Council's recess. Specifically, it permits the Committee to hold meetings to take official action on measures, provided that they give at least 48 hours' notice to the public regarding the meeting details and the measures to be discussed. Additionally, it allows other committees to meet and take action on sequentially referred measures prior to the Committee of the Whole's meeting, as long as they also provide appropriate notice.
This amendment is set to expire on September 15, 2025, and is intended to enhance the efficiency of the Council's operations by enabling legislative actions to continue even during recess periods. The resolution will take effect immediately upon its passage.
